sydney cricket ground pitch report

The Sydney track is expected to be batting friendly, allowing the ball to come onto the bat well to play strokes. While fast bowlers may have to work hard to find movement, spinners are likely to find support and grip as the match progresses. Historically in ODI matches at this venue, teams batting first have had a significant advantage, winning 96 of the 168 matches, although some analysts speculate that chasing will have the advantage in this specific game. This is in contrast to the ground’s traditional Test match reputation as Australia’s most spin-friendly wicket and the recent anomaly in January 2025, when the grassy pitch heavily aided seam bowlers.

Sydney Cricket Ground statistics and records

  • Total matches: 168
  • Matches won by batting first: 96
  • Matches won by bowling first:66
  • Average score of first innings: 224
  • Average score of second innings:189
  • highest total recorded: 408/5 (25.5 overs) South Africa vs West Indies
  • Lowest total recorded: 63/10 (26.3 overs) India vs Australia
  • highest score chased: 334/8 (49.2 overs) Australia vs England
  • lowest score defended: 101/9 (30 overs) Australia vs West Indies
